AMIOT (Joseph-Marie) - The Missionaries of Peking. Mémoires concernant l'histoire, les sciences, les arts, les moeurs, les usages, [...] des Chinois. Paris, Nyon, 1776-1791. 9 vol. in-4° bound in full leopard-printed fawn calf, spine ribbed, decorated and gilt. triple fillet stamped on the covers, double fillet gilt on the edges (Binding of the period). Decorated with a frontispiece and 142 plates engraved out of text of views, linguistic plates, military structures, etc. First edition. An authoritative work on China at the time, written by missionaries including Joseph Amiot and Aloys Kao, dealing with linguistic, cultural, geopolitical, military and artistic issues... Our copy comprises 9 of the 15 volumes in this edition. Good condition, some browned pages and plates, slight foxing. Comprising mainly works from the eighteenth and twentieth centuries, this collection covers more than five centuries of printed production, closely linked to the history of Geneva and the Tronchin family, one of the city's great patrician lineages, now extinct. A number of seventeenth-century titles hark back to the origins of this lineage, notably around the figure of Théodore Tronchin (lot 2567). However, it was in the 18th century, with the acquisition of the Bessinge estate by Jacob Tronchin in 1764, that the collection really took shape. The works, many of which bear the bookplates of Jean Armand Tronchin (1732-1813) and his son Henri (1794-1865), make up a collection faithful to the ideals of the Enlightenment, combining public law, classical humanities, science, travel accounts (lots 2471, 2479, 2554..), major works of 18th-century printing - including the plan of Paris by Turgot (lot 2591) - and rare editions bearing the royal coat of arms, such as those of Madame de Pompadour (lot 2545). At the turn of the 20th century, a new page was turned when Xavier Givaudan (1867-1966), a leading figure in the industrial boom alongside his brother Léon Givaudan (1875-1936) in the fields of synthetic perfume, chemicals and soap, established in Switzerland in 1917, acquired the estate in 1938 after renting it for several years. The library and works have been preserved and in part passed on to his descendants. His brother Léon Givaudan built up a bibliophile collection focusing on Art Deco books, bringing together works sublimated by bindings signed by the great contemporary bookbinders (lots 2606, 2626, 2648, etc.). His library was sold at auction in Paris on 3 June 1988. André Givaudan (1895-1973), Xavier Givaudan's son, also had a particular interest in literature, joining several bibliophile societies and adding a number of modern illustrated books to the collection.
